Willett, James D.; Keefe, David D. – 1998
This paper describes the use of distance learning capabilities to augment and amplify the learning opportunities for part-time graduate students at George Mason University. The students in the biochemistry course described meet periodically on campus for brief interactions with the instructor and peer classmates. Between these synchronous…
